TheBrain features and specs

  • Visual Information Management
    TheBrain offers a dynamic visual interface that helps users manage and navigate through complex information easily. This visual representation makes it easier to understand relationships and dependencies among different pieces of data.
  • Flexible Organization
    The software allows for flexible organization of data, enabling users to link notes, files, and web pages in a non-linear manner. This is beneficial for users who prefer a non-traditional, more interconnected way of organizing their information.
  • Cross-Platform Accessibility
    TheBrain is available across multiple platforms, including Windows, macOS, iOS, and Android. This ensures that users can access their data from virtually any device, facilitating better productivity on the go.
  • Integration Capabilities
    TheBrain provides integration with popular tools like Dropbox, Google Drive, and Evernote, making it easier to sync and share information across different platforms and devices.
  • Advanced Search Functionality
    The software includes powerful search tools that allow users to quickly locate information within their Brain by keyword, tags, or other criteria. This is particularly useful for managing large volumes of information.

Possible disadvantages of TheBrain

  • Steep Learning Curve
    TheBrain's unique visual interface and non-linear approach require a significant amount of time to learn and master. New users may find it challenging to get started and make the most of its features.
  • High Cost
    Compared to other mind mapping or information management tools, TheBrain can be relatively expensive. The Pro version especially comes at a higher cost, which might not be feasible for all users, particularly individual or small-scale users.
  • Limited Export Options
    While TheBrain offers several options for importing data, the export functionality is somewhat limited. Users may find it difficult to migrate their data out of TheBrain and into other platforms.
  • Performance Issues with Large Databases
    As the volume of information within a single 'Brain' grows, users may experience performance issues such as slower load times and lag, which can hinder productivity.
  • Dependence on Proprietary Format
    TheBrain uses a proprietary file format that makes it challenging to transfer data to other applications. This can create issues related to data portability and long-term accessibility.

Lambda School features and specs

  • Income Share Agreement
    Lambda School offers an Income Share Agreement (ISA), allowing students to defer tuition payments until they secure a job making at least $50,000 per year. This reduces upfront financial risk for students.
  • Remote Learning
    The program is entirely online, providing flexibility for students to learn from anywhere in the world.
  • Comprehensive Curriculum
    Lambda School offers a comprehensive curriculum that covers a wide range of in-demand tech skills, including web development, data science, and machine learning.
  • Career Services
    The school provides extensive career services, including job placement support, resume reviews, and interview preparation to help students secure employment after graduation.
  • No Upfront Cost
    Students can enroll without any upfront cost, making the program accessible to those who may not have the financial means to pay for a traditional coding boot camp.

Possible disadvantages of Lambda School

  • High Deferred Cost
    Although there are no upfront costs, the total cost of the ISA can be high, potentially up to $30,000, which is more expensive than some other coding boot camps.
  • Intensive Time Commitment
    The program is very intensive and requires full-time dedication, which can be challenging for individuals who need to balance other responsibilities such as work or family.
  • Variable Job Market
    Job placement success can vary significantly. While many students do find jobs, some may struggle, particularly in a competitive job market.
  • Risk of Debt
    If a student does not secure a high-paying job immediately, the deferred tuition can become a financial burden, particularly if the student is unable to make the minimum required salary.
  • Limited Financial Assistance
    Since the program relies heavily on ISAs, there may be limited options for students seeking traditional financial assistance or loans.

Analysis of TheBrain

Overall verdict

  • TheBrain is considered a powerful tool for individuals and organizations looking to effectively manage and visualize complex data. It might have a steeper learning curve compared to simpler mind-mapping tools, but its ability to handle intricate information webs makes it a valuable resource for the right user.

Why this product is good

  • TheBrain is a knowledge management and mind mapping software that allows users to visually organize information, ideas, and relationships. It offers features like linking notes, files, and web pages, which make it a versatile tool for managing complex information. Users appreciate its dynamic interface, which helps in understanding and navigating through intricate networks of data. Additionally, it supports cross-platform usage and synchronization, which is beneficial for users who need access from multiple devices.

Recommended for

    TheBrain is recommended for knowledge workers, researchers, project managers, and anyone who needs to organize large amounts of interconnected information. It is particularly useful for individuals who prefer visual representation and need to manage tasks, projects, and ideas in a non-linear fashion.
